I have a pair of Quasar/JCPenney twins that look just like this. They have 3 speeds on them and date from 1981. The earlier 2-speed VCR's are better in video quality because of the thicker heads. To get SLP, they give it thinner heads. They don't read as intense of a signal from the magnetic "track" as a full-sized head would. I have a 1977 JVC HR-3300 (the very first VHS) with an absolutely beautiful picture. It has the wider 2-hr heads.
New heads for these old tanks are relatively cheap ($30 or so). I'd seriously consider dropping new heads in it while they are still available. This will roll back the odometer significantly for excellent performance in its next 30 years.
